A dataset containing 4460 species occurrences available in GBIF matching the query: Country: Haiti HasCoordinate: true TaxonKey: Plantae HasGeospatialIssue: false. The dataset includes 4460 records from 42 constituent datasets: 228 records from A global database for the distributions of crop wild relatives. 7 records from Phanerogamic Botanical Collections (S). 3 records from University of Vienna, Institute for Botany - Herbarium WU. 94 records from Naturalis Biodiversity Center (NL) - Botany. 2 records from Herbario Nacional Colombiano (COL). 1 records from SPF - Herbário da Universidade de São Paulo. 1 records from A Distribution and Taxonomic Reference Dataset of Geranium (Geraniaceae) in the New World. 1 records from La colección briológica del Herbario Nacional (MEXU). Actualización 2000. 35 records from Bioversity Collecting Mission Database. 1 records from Herbarium - Instituto Nacional de Pesquisas da Amazônia (INPA). 8 records from Australia's Virtual Herbarium. 2 records from UCBG TAPIR Provider. 1 records from CONN. 11 records from Geneva Herbarium – De Candolle's Prodromus (G-DC). 1447 records from Tropicos Specimen Data. 193 records from Natural History Museum (London) Collection Specimens. 305 records from NMNH Extant Specimen Records. 1 records from Australian Antarctic Division Herbarium. 51 records from Fairchild Tropical Botanic Garden Virtual Herbarium Darwin Core format. 2 records from The AAU Herbarium Database. 18 records from CSIC-Real Jardín Botánico-Colección de Plantas Vasculares (MA). 8 records from Paleobiology Database. 3 records from Herbarium (UNA). 1 records from MEXU/Colección de Briofitas. 7 records from United States National Plant Germplasm System Collection. 12 records from The System-wide Information Network for Genetic Resources (SINGER). 19 records from Harvard University Herbaria. 11 records from Field Museum of Natural History (Botany) Bryophyte Collection. 22 records from USF Herbarium. 2 records from Computarización del Herbario ENCB. Fase II. Base de datos de los ejemplares de la familia Burseraceae y Nyctaginaceae y base de datos digitalizada de los ejemplares tipo de plantas vasculares del Herbario de la Escuela Nacional de Ciencias Biológicas. 159 records from Field Museum of Natural History (Botany) Seed Plant Collection. 6 records from SINGER Coordinator. 4 records from Field Museum of Natural History (Botany) Pteridophyte Collection. 2 records from Lund Botanical Museum (LD). 2 records from Geographically tagged INSDC sequences. 3 records from Field Museum of Natural History (Botany) Lichen Collection. 52 records from USF Herbarium. 223 records from University of Florida Herbarium (FLAS). 65 records from Royal Botanic Gardens, Kew - Herbarium Specimens. 1177 records from The New York Botanical Garden Herbarium (NY) - Vascular Plant Collection. 267 records from Geneva Herbarium – General Collection (G). 3 records from CAS Botany (BOT).
